Less than $15

Sep. 17, 2012 LA COMPAGNIE RHODANIENNE Côtes du Rhône Jean Berteau Réserve 2011 (87 points, $10)

Offers a nice burly feel, featuring roasted bay leaf and chestnut notes, with a solid core of crushed cherry and plum fruit and a light toasty finish. Drink now. 10,000 cases made. —James Molesworth


$15 to $30

Sep. 17, 2012 ARGYLE Brut Willamette Valley 2008 (90 points, $27)

A light, airy style delivers plenty of pear and pineapple fruit, keeping the balance delicate and fresh. This shows a refreshing balance, and the flavors persist. Drink now. 11,250 cases made. —Harvey Steiman


More than $30

Sep. 17, 2012 CONCHA Y TORO Cabernet Sauvignon Puente Alto Don Melchor 2008 (94 points, $95)

This ripe, dense red delivers base notes of humus, mocha and toasty oak supporting the rich cassis, black cherry and dark plum fruit character. There's fine tannins for support, but this is all rich fruit on the spicy finish. Drink now through 2018. 13,000 cases made. —Nathan Wesley
